]> git.saurik.com Git - apple/xnu.git/blobdiff - osfmk/i386/task.h
xnu-4570.71.2.tar.gz
[apple/xnu.git] / osfmk / i386 / task.h
index c35069ab6f5f0dba49b687974728c812bf44bce6..0ca7d549e80a3c68e92db90fa014b8b87f886286 100644 (file)
  */
 
 /*
  */
 
 /*
- * No machine dependant task fields
+ * Machine dependant task fields
  */
 
  */
 
-#define MACHINE_TASK
+#include <i386/user_ldt.h>
+#include <i386/fpu.h>
+
+#define MACHINE_TASK                           \
+       struct user_ldt *       i386_ldt;       \
+       void*                   task_debug;     \
+       uint64_t        uexc_range_start;       \
+       uint64_t        uexc_range_size;        \
+       uint64_t        uexc_handler;           \
+       xstate_t        xstate;
+